DECEMBER MADNESS
Finals end tomorrow at UConn and I’ll be curious to see if there are any changes in the players when we see them at practice.
It’s got to be a big adjustment from being a high school player to now balancing so much and Jim Calhoun has even hinted that some Huskies have handled it better than others. Speaking on Thursday’s Big East teleconference, he talked about the giddiness of his team at recent practices, a sign of perhaps some lingering stress.
Dealing with academics and finals was a topic of conversation for other coaches as well, including Jerry Wainwright. DePaul’s coach has it a little different though since his school is on the lesser-used quarter system.
The Blue Demons’ players actually had to push up their finals because of the team’s appearance at the Maui Invitational. With tests to worry about and practice time cut down by a week nationwide, that combination might explain part of DePaul’s unexpected 0-2 start (the team is 5-3 since).
